Job description

The IT Support Specialist provides technical support through troubleshooting, diagnostics, installation, and system maintenance to meet the Information Systems needs of the agency.

The IT Support Specialist is responsible for the following:

  • Provide support to end-user issues in the EMR system with an emphasis on providing excellent customer experience.
  • Provides technical support to associates on software, laptops, mobile devices, Microsoft Office 365, printers and networks, and other designated applications.
  • Supports end users via phone and remote support tools. Provides in-person support when necessary to a 30-mile radius of ownership hospital systems.
  • Tests, troubleshoots and maintains software, laptops and mobile devices.
  • Communicates changes and issues affecting applications or users of applications.
  • Monitors the inventory of laptops and mobile devices which includes ordering, replacement of damaged goods as well as obtaining replacement parts or component pieces.
  • Support the management of the agency directories regularly for accuracy.
  • Responsible for the administration of cloud-based phone systems and web fax.
  • Maintains agency network infrastructure including switch, firewall, and access points.
  • Monitors network health via cloud-based portal to ensure security risks are identified.
  • Maintains email exchange server and educates staff on the use of Microsoft Office 365 products.
  • Diligently log all development and support activities in agency Help Desk portal.
  • Works with confidential patient information and complies with HIPAA.
  • Supports wireless connectivity for laptops and mobile devices.
  • Effectively manages time to ensure technical issues are resolved to a timely manner.
  • Prepares iPad’s and laptops for end user deployment and provides orientation to new staff on use of devices
  • Responsible for mobile device management for all end-users
  • Develops training materials and procedures for end-users.
  • Continuing education may be required as the needs of the agencies adapt over time.
  • Participate in on-call rotation for helpdesk issues after hours as well as weekends and holidays as necessary
  • Other duties as assigned

Requirements

Do you have experience in Software installation?, Do you have a Bachelor’s degree?, * Bachelor’s degree in an IT related field of study or equivalent experience is required.

  • Must possess troubleshooting and problem-solving knowledge of laptops and mobile devices.
  • Ability to demonstrate an understanding of network troubleshooting including configuration, installation and upgrades.
  • Must possess exc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to resolve technical issues quickly and accurately.
  • Knowledge of Windows 10 Operating System troubleshooting and configuration.
  • Microsoft O365 installation, configuration and troubleshooting knowledge required.
  • Laptop hardware installation, configuration, and troubleshooting knowledge required.
  • Must understand and enforce guidelines and best practices for Patient Health Information (PHI) in accordance with CMS and HIPAA
